Изменен пароль - теперь невозможно войти в мою учетную запись (полное шифрование диска + зашифрованная домашняя папка)

Итак, я использую Ubuntu 15.10. У меня есть полная настройка шифрования диска и зашифрованная домашняя папка, я понимаю, что это глупо, но я не понимал, что я выбираю, когда настраиваю его, и никогда не пытался изменить его.

Итак, вчера через терминал я сменил свой аккаунт + пароль root. Затем я попытался запустить компьютер этим утром, я попадаю на страницу входа в учетную запись, пытаюсь войти ... она мигает, а затем возвращается на страницу входа. Я понимаю, что это потому, что моя домашняя папка не может быть расшифрована.

Я нашел несколько руководств в сети, чтобы справиться с этим [ невозможно войти в систему после смены пароля (ecryptfs) ], однако я не могу загрузиться в Linux из-за полного шифрования диска.

У меня есть весь пароль (старый + новый), и у меня есть длинная строковая фраза (которая, я думаю, соответствует полному шифрованию диска).

Я бы очень признателен за вашу помощь. У меня есть действительно важная информация об этом ноутбуке, и я не делал резервных копий в течение нескольких месяцев.

1
задан 13 April 2017 в 15:24

1 ответ

Для пользы полноты я отправляю решение, которое мы нашли во время нашего разговора в разделе комментариев как ответ:

В первую очередь, Вы, вероятно, можете загрузиться в свою систему Linux, Вы не можете просто смочь войти в систему графически, так как графический вход в систему обычно пробует к чтению-записи в Вашем корневом каталоге. Можно все еще попытаться войти в систему с помощью виртуальной консоли (Ctrl + Высокий звук + F1) и работать оттуда.

Используя Живой CD вместо этого должен также работать. Можно смонтировать зашифрованный системный раздел с Живого CD, также. Например, можно работать gnome-disk-utility на Вашем Живом CD и decrypt+mount Ваш системный раздел оттуда графически.

Кроме того, предостерегитесь это, инструкции в связанном учебном руководстве предполагают, что Вы зарегистрированы как пользователь, чей домой Вы хотите спасти. Если Вы зарегистрированы как другой пользователь (например, корень), то заменяете команду

ecryptfs-rewrap-passphrase ~/.ecryptfs/wrapped-passphrase

чем-то как

ecryptfs-rewrap-passphrase /home/[the-user-you-whose-home-you-want-to-rewrap]/.ecryptfs/wrapped-passphrase

или (на Живом CD) чем-то как

ecryptfs-rewrap-passphrase /[wherever-you-temporarily-mounted-the-home-partition]/[the-user-you-whose-home-you-want-to-rewrap]/.ecryptfs/wrapped-passphrase
1
ответ дан 14 April 2017 в 01:24
  • 1
    Это работало очень хорошо на меня. Даже терминал гнома запустил показ снова. – shaoyl85 4 December 2018 в 12:45

Другие вопросы по тегам:

Похожие вопросы: